About

I am a Licensed Clinical Mental Health Counselor and have been in practice since 2018 after obtaining my master’s degree from Montreat College. Additionally, I am currently licensed with the National Board of Certified Counselors and am also a Licensed Clinical Addiction Specialist licensed with the North Carolina Addiction Specialist Professional Practice Board.

I have served diverse people on an ACTT team and with a men’s residential substance use program in Asheville, NC. I have worked as a crisis hospital advocate with Our Voice, Inc. and I have also offered courses for CEU’s on sex trafficking to various groups. I currently provide in-home therapy to families where the identified client is at risk of out of home placement. This involves working with a family from a systems based approach across school, home, legal, social services, and prosocial involvement to effect change using a variety of tools from modalities such as Internal Family Systems,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, Dialectical Behavioral Therapy, Motivational Interviewing, and Art based therapy. In addition I offer private counseling services to individuals aged 13 and up with focuses on a variety of issues including personality disorders, substance use, depression, anxiety, PTSD, grief/loss, anger management as well as life stressors, such as divorce, moves, and new jobs. My primary approach to counseling is integrative derived heavily from cognitive behavioral therapy with a trauma informed approach.

My role is to assist you in reaching whatever goals you may have for yourself by providing nonjudgmental support and helping to facilitate your journey. I strive to empower you and assist you in expanding healthy awareness, rather than to give you advice. With that said, I also like to be action oriented with specific treatment goals in mind as we work through the reasons you have sought help. You are the expert on you and I am here to support and promote new discoveries. I want you to feel heard, validated, and supported on this journey you have undertaken and I take great joy in every step, small or great, my clients take. I enjoy being creative with a client to devise a plan specific to them to gain success and overcome obstacles in their lives.

Is Online Therapy the Right Choice for Your Mental Health Journey?

Many people ask whether connecting with a therapist online truly helps. For a range of common concerns – such as stress, anxiety, depression, relationship difficulties, or major life transitions – research indicates that online therapy can be comparable in effectiveness to in-person care.

One of the main benefits is convenience and flexibility. Clients can meet with a therapist in the format that fits their life best, whether by video call, phone session, live chat, or in-app messaging. This flexibility often makes it easier to keep consistent appointments and integrate therapeutic work into a busy schedule.

Sessions are provided by licensed professionals, and if someone ever wants a different therapeutic fit they can switch to another therapist. For many people seeking help with everyday mental health challenges, online therapy offers a practical and effective option for support and progress.
